
Webull Corporation (NASDAQ:BULL – Free Report) – Northland Securities issued their Q1 2027 earnings per share estimates for shares of Webull in a research report issued on Friday, June 26th. Northland Securities analyst M. Grondahl forecasts that the company will post earnings per share of $0.03 for the quarter. Northland Securities also issued estimates for Webull’s Q2 2027 earnings at $0.04 EPS, Q3 2027 earnings at $0.04 EPS, Q4 2027 earnings at $0.05 EPS and FY2027 earnings at $0.17 EPS.
Several other equities research analysts have also recently commented on BULL. Wall Street Zen cut Webull from a “hold” rating to a “sell” rating in a research note on Saturday, May 2nd. Weiss Ratings cut Webull from a “sell (d-)” rating to a “sell (e+)” rating in a report on Tuesday, June 23rd. Rosenblatt Securities reaffirmed a “buy” rating and set a $12.00 price objective on shares of Webull in a research report on Wednesday, June 10th. Finally, Compass Point initiated coverage on shares of Webull in a research report on Monday, March 9th. They set a “buy” rating and a $9.00 price objective for the company. One equities research analyst has rated the stock with a Strong Buy rating, two have issued a Buy rating, one has issued a Hold rating and one has given a Sell rating to the company. Based on data from MarketBeat.com, Webull has a consensus rating of “Moderate Buy” and a consensus target price of $13.00.

Webull Company Profile
Webull Financial LLC is a commission-free online brokerage platform that provides individual investors with access to U.S. equities, exchange-traded funds (ETFs), options, and cryptocurrencies. Through its mobile and desktop applications, the company offers real-time market data, advanced charting tools, customizable watchlists, and streamlined order execution. Webull’s platform is designed to support both self-directed traders and investors seeking an intuitive interface coupled with professional-grade analytics.
In addition to its core trading services, Webull delivers educational resources and research tools to help users make informed decisions.
